Henry Mancini was born on April 16, 1924, and was an American composer, conductor, arranger, pianist and flautist. He won 4 Academy Awards, 1 Golden Globe and 20 Grammys for his compositions. Mancini's "Love Theme from Romeo and Juliet" was #1 on the Billboard charts for 2 weeks in 1969. He passed away in 1994.
